- W2000808163 abstract "An event by event analysis is carried out for all charged particles observed in central collisions of $^{40}mathrm{Ar}$ + KCl and $^{40}mathrm{Ar}$ + Pb at 1.808 and 0.772 GeV/nucleon, respectively. Total transverse energy is used for impact parameter selection within the central trigger condition. The central Ar + KCl reaction exhibits a forward-backward oriented momentum flux. The flux distribution of the most central Ar + Pb events is approximately isotropic in the fireball center of mass.NUCLEAR REACTIONS $^{40}mathrm{Ar}$ + KCl, $frac{E}{A}=1.808$ GeV, and $^{40}mathrm{Ar}$ + Pb, $frac{E}{A}=0.772$ GeV. Central collision trigger, all charged particles measured event by event, streamer chamber. Momentum flux distribution parameters deduced." @default.
